OnColor™ UL 94 Colorants* • More than 2,000 recognized concentrates available worldwide in all color options • HB rating for most of PP, PS, ABS, PC/ABS, PBT, PA, PA-GF, TPU generic resins • V-0, V-1, V-2 and 5VA/5VB ratings for more than 200 specific engineering resins • Master file of recognized concentrates with scope of use accessible in the UL product finder • Development of custom products for specific resins upon request • Compliance Letters available for REACH and RoHS Cesa™ Flame Retardant Additives for Glow Wire • Fire performance in line with different levels of Glow Wire temperatures (IEC 60695-2-12) • Let-Down Ratio adjustable to reach different levels of Glow Wire temperatures • Non-halogen (in accordance with IEC 61249- 2-21) and non-HBCD** solutions • Wide range of solutions adapted to different polymers (PP, PS, PC) • Color and flame retardants can be combined in one product • Compliance Letters available for REACH and RoHS APPLICATION BULLETIN * Solutions also sold as Renol™ UL 94 Colorants APPLICATION POLYMER GWFI TEMPERATURE TYPICAL LET-DOWN RATIO CONTENT HIPS 750–960°C 5–10% Non-HBCD flame retardant** PC 850–960°C 2–4% Non-halogen in accordance with IEC 61249-2-21 PP homopolymer 850–960°C 4% Non-halogen in accordance with IEC 61249-2-21 PP copolymer 850–960°C 4–8% Antioxidant - metal deactivator ** Non-HBCD means that Hexabromocyclododecane (HBCD) is neither used as starting material during the mixing phase of our products nor intentionally added during production, but it cannot be excluded that it is not present at level of ubiquitous traces in any of the raw materials used in manufacturing of our products.

VERSAFLEX PKG 4345, 4355, 4365 VERSAFLEX PKG 4465 VERSAFLEX PKG 4570 VERSAFLEX PKG 4665 Chemical Compatibility Soaps, low-cost solution for non-polar oils Soaps, some oils Polar & non-polar oils, non-polar solvents Non-polar oils (abrasion resistant) Regulatory Compliance* REACH SVHC, FDA 21 CFR EU 10/2011 REACH SVHC & FDA 21 CFR REACH SVHC & FDA CFR REACH SVHC & FDA CFR Hardness 45A, 55A, 65A 65A 70A 65A Overmolded Substrate Polypropylene Polypropylene Polycarbonate ABS PC/ABS Polycarbonate ABS PC/ABS Color Translucent Translucent Natural Natural * Please contact Avient for additional information HOW CHEMICALLY COMPATIBLE VERSAFLEX PKG TPEs MAKE THE DIFFERENCE IN COSMETIC PACKAGING Chemical compatibility – Versaflex PKG TPEs do not discolor, etch, crack or delaminate when in contact with most soaps, lotions, oils, surfactants and solvents found in cosmetics.
